What Is an AOS Degree in Information Technology?
An Partner in Occupational Researches (AOS) in Infotech is a career-oriented degree that blends class theory with real-world application. Unlike standard associate degrees that emphasize general education, the AOS degree concentrates primarily on job-specific training and technological skill growth. This makes it a solid choice for students that intend to go into the labor force promptly with a solid foundation in IT.

This IT Degree normally covers core locations such as networking, cybersecurity, computer systems, software and hardware assistance, data source management, and programs. Pupils additionally gain problem-solving abilities and experience with industry-standard tools and platforms that employers value.

Secret Features of an Infotech (AOS) Program
Hands-On Training:
AOS programs are understood for their functional approach. Trainees typically deal with real-world tasks, imitate IT circumstances, and gain experience with current modern technologies.

Industry-Relevant Educational program:
Coursework is created to align with present patterns and company expectations. Subjects may include network administration, information safety, systems evaluation, and computer system support.

Accreditation Preparation:
Several AOS degree programs prepare students for industry-recognized qualifications such as CompTIA A+, Network+, Safety+, and Cisco's CCNA.

Flexible Learning Options:
Programs might offer both day and night courses, online discovering, and hybrid formats to suit various timetables and way of lives.

Job Services Assistance:
Leading IT colleges assist trainees with return to writing, interview preparation, and job positioning to help them land settings after college graduation.

Profession Opportunities with an IT Degree
Graduates with an Infotech Degree from an AOS program are prepared for a variety of entry-level roles in the technology sector, such as:

IT Support Expert

Network Administrator

Computer Service technician

Help Workdesk Expert

Equipments Administrator

Cybersecurity Professional

With additional education and experience, these duties can result in senior settings such as IT Supervisor, Network Designer, or Information Security Analyst.
